site stats

Rt thread i2c 硬件

WebJan 8, 2011 · 本函数用于向系统中注册I2C 总线设备。. 参数. bus. I2C 总线设备句柄. bus_name. I2C 总线设备名称,一般与硬件控制器名称一致,如:“i2c0”. 返回. RT_EOK 成 … WebOct 22, 2024 · 处理好上面的相关内容后,还有一些宏的使用,以及硬件IIC使用的是那些IO口,然后跟裸机一样的情形,需要回到对硬件的一些初始化操作。这里有一些细节说明,根据IIC的操作时序,给寄存器写值之前,首先需要写入寄存器的地址,因此msg.buf 中需要包含寄存器的地址,和后续写入的值,如要写入 ...

从菜鸟到起飞的 RT-Thread 开发指南 - 知乎 - 知乎专栏

WebJun 7, 2024 · I2C 设备的具体使用方式可以参考如下示例代码,示例代码的主要步骤如下:. 首先根据I2C 设备名称查找I2C 名称,获取设备句柄,然后初始化aht10 传感器。. 控制传 … WebAug 7, 2024 · 封装了I2C对象的初始化函数;IO引脚的读写驱动函数;模拟IIC硬件IO的初始化函数(使用自动初始化机制). i2c-bit-ops.c. 根据IIC时序实现IIC读写接口 i2c_bit_xfer … hipaa violation letter to credit bureau https://boldinsulation.com

RT-Thread设备和驱动总结_编程设计_IT干货网

WebJan 8, 2011 · 本函数用于向系统中注册I2C 总线设备。. 参数. bus. I2C 总线设备句柄. bus_name. I2C 总线设备名称,一般与硬件控制器名称一致,如:“i2c0”. 返回. RT_EOK 成功;-RT_ERROR 注册失败,已有其他驱动使用该bus_name注册。. rt_size_t rt_i2c_transfer. WebJul 15, 2024 · 本篇详细的记录了如何使用STM32CubeMX配置STM32L431RCT6的硬件I2C外设,读取SHT30温湿度传感器的数据并通过串口发送。 ... RT-Thread Studio 是一站式的 RT-Thread 开发工具,通过简单易用的图形化配置系统以及丰富的软件包和组件资源,让物联网开发变得简单和高效。 ... Web由于 RT-Thread 上层应用 API 的通用性,因此这些代码不局限于具体的硬件平台,用户可以轻松将它移植到其它平台上。 启用 I2C 设备驱动. 使用 env 工具 命令行进入 rt … hipaa violations fines

RT-Thread设备驱动开发指南 - QQ阅读

Category:RT-thread 设备驱动组件之IIC总线设备 - King先生 - 博客园

Tags:Rt thread i2c 硬件

Rt thread i2c 硬件

RT-Thread 带你趟过 I2C 的坑_51CTO博客_RT-THREAD

Web访问 I2C 总线设备. 一般情况下 MCU 的 I2C 器件都是作为主机和从机通讯,在 RT-Thread 中将 I2C 主机虚拟为 I2C总线设备,I2C 从机通过 I2C 设备接口和 I2C 总线通讯,相关接口 … WebNov 11, 2024 · 硬件设计,为了降低单片机的功耗与保护芯片引脚,在满足负载电流和负载电容相关要求的前提下,阻值设置通常比较大。 ... SDA 从机最多需要 9 个时钟信号,也就是异常复位后,MCU 至少发送需要 9 个时钟信号,完成 i2c 总线的 SDA 解锁。所以,RT_Thread …

Rt thread i2c 硬件

Did you know?

WebAug 11, 2024 · RT-Thread软件包是运行于RT-Thread物联网操作系统平台上,面向不同应用领域的通用软件组件 。 RT-Thread 同时提供了开放的软件包平台,为开发者提供了众多 … WebNov 16, 2024 · 2 硬件问题汇总 ... SDA 从机最多需要 9 个时钟信号,也就是异常复位后,MCU 至少发送需要 9 个时钟信号,完成 i2c 总线的 SDA 解锁。所以,RT_Thread 为了避 …

WebMay 21, 2024 · 温馨提示: 由于我们没设置RTC硬件备份,所以这个时间设置仅仅是当前有效,当重新断电重启的时候,又会恢复为原来最开始的时间 ... I2C的基本原理之前在公众号就有相应的文章了,很早之前发的,接下来我们来学习RT-Thread I2C总线设备的使用! Web因为 RT-Thread 还有许多优点,包括它支持非常多的硬件平台,还拥有及其丰富的组件和软件包(包括文件系统、网络、IoT、AI、传感器等等),提供了便捷的开发环境和 IDE 工具,以及有众多技术文档、参考设计和活跃的开发者社区,这些都能帮助您快速入门和 ...

WebMar 29, 2024 · 本文以6轴惯性传感器MPU6050为例,使用RT-Thread I2C设备驱动框架提供的GPIO模拟I2C控制器的方式,阐述了应用程序如何使用I2C设备驱动接口访问I2C设备。 图2-1 RT-Thread I2C设备驱动框架. 3 运行I2C设备驱动示例代码. 3.1 示例代码软硬件平台. 正点原子STM32F4探索者开发板 WebNov 13, 2024 · RT-Thread的I2C驱动,分为两种类型:硬件I2C和软件I2C。. 在stm32的BSP中提供了软件I2C的驱动,不过为了全面介绍,硬件I2C的对接,作者也进行简单的对 …

Webart-pi 是 rt-thread 团队经过半年的精心准备,专门为嵌入式软件工程师、开源创客设计的一款极具扩展功能的 diy 开源硬件。 art-pi 工业扩展板. art-pi 工业扩展板支持工业控制领域常用的接口协议,助力工控领域的开发与应用。 ... - i2c; 创意 demo. art-pi 开源 sdk 仓库 ...

Web3.2 Finsh/MSH 测试命令. at24cxx 软件包提供了丰富的测试命令,项目只要在 RT-Thread 上开启 Finsh/MSH 功能即可。. 在做一些基于 at24cxx 的应用开发、调试时,这些命令会非常实用,它可以准确的读取指传感器测量的温度与湿度。. 具体功能可以输入 at24cxx ,可以查看 … hipaa violation form print outWebNov 25, 2024 · 1、i2c协议 由飞利浦公司开发,支持设备间的短距离通信。i2c通信需要的引脚少,硬件实现简单、可扩展性强,被广泛应用在系统内多个集成电路(IC)间的通信。2、i2c物理层 i2c通信总线可连接多个i2c通信设备,支持多个通信主机和多个通信从机。i2c通信只需要两条双向总线——SDA(串行数据线)和 ... hipaa violations civil or criminalhipaa violations can result inWebNov 28, 2024 · 将硬件I2C巧妙地将“嫁接”到RTT原生的模拟I2C驱动框架I2C. 将软件模拟I2C和硬件I2C,分别做对比,其实还可以发现,硬件I2C有更大优势。. 优势1:硬件I2C的相关 … hipaa violation medical records mishandlingWebJul 19, 2015 · 三、IIC总线设备初始化. 1、在应用IIC总线设备驱动时,需要用到rt_device_read或rt_device_write,因此在初始化函数中需要调用rt_device_open将IIC总线设备打开。. 在上面两个函数中,有符号整型32位pos的高16位表示flags,低16位表示IIC器件地址。. flags取值如i2c.h文件中宏 ... hipaa violation penalty structureWebMar 30, 2024 · 本书由自研开源嵌入式实时操作系统RT-Thread核心开发者撰写,专业性毋庸置疑,系统讲解RT-Thread设备驱动开发方法,剖析26种设备驱动开发案例,助力开发者快速掌握RT-Thread设备驱动开发技能。. 本书的内容共27章,分为三篇。. 基础篇(第1~11章),先对RT-Thread ... homer laughlin theme eggshellWeb因为 RT-Thread 还有许多优点,包括它支持非常多的硬件平台,还拥有及其丰富的组件和软件包(包括文件系统、网络、IoT、AI、传感器等等),提供了便捷的开发环境和 IDE 工 … hipaa violation in workplace